I have a doubt. I have recently transferred my old PF account from a previous employer to my current employer, and the PF amount has been transferred. However, the pension amount still shows in the old PF account. What should I do now? Whom should I approach regarding this? My previous PF account is maintained by the government only, not by any trust. How can I transfer the pension amount?

Pension will not transfer in this case; only the length of service will transfer. So, it will show a 0/- amount in the pension part in the new PF account. Don't worry, your pension will be safe. The pension amount will be settled based on the length of service.
